Low dimensional manifold embedding for scattering coefficients of intrapartum fetale heart rate variability

V. Chudacek, R. Talmon, J. Anden, S. Mallat, R. R. Coifman, P. Abry, M. Doret

Research output: Chapter in Book/Report/Conference proceedingConference contributionpeer-review

Abstract

Intrapartum fetal surveillance for early detection of fetal acidosis in clinical practice focuses on reducing neonatal morbidity via early detection. It is the subject of on going research studies attempting notably to improve detection performance by reducing false positive rate. In that context, the present contribution tailors to fetal heart rate variability analysis a graph-based dimensionality reduction procedure performed on scattering coefficients. Applied to a high quality and well-documented database constituted by obstetricians from a French academic hospital, the low dimensional embedding enables to distinguish between the temporal dynamics of healthy and acidotic fetuses, as well as to achieve satisfactory detection performance detection compared to those obtained by the clinical-benchmark FIGO criteria.
